РОЗРОБНИК ПРОГРАМНОГО ЗАБЕЗПЕЧЕННЯ-ФРІЛАНС: обов’язки, зарплата та як ними стати

Робота позаштатного розробника програмного забезпечення
Фото: CareerFoundry
Зміст приховувати
  1. Незалежний розробник програмного забезпечення
  2. Переваги стати позаштатним розробником програмного забезпечення
    1. #1. Збільште свій дохід
    2. #2. Ви відповідальний
    3. #3. Міжнародний охоплення 
    4. №4. Гнучкість
  3. Недоліки позаштатного розробника програмного забезпечення
    1. #1. Нестабільна зайнятість 
    2. #2. Фінансова нестабільність
    3. #3. Напружений графік 
  4. Посадова інструкція позаштатного розробника програмного забезпечення
  5. Зарплата позаштатного розробника програмного забезпечення
  6. Як стати позаштатним розробником програмного забезпечення 
    1. #1. Розвивайте свою нішу
    2. #2. Встановіть чіткі очікування
    3. #3. Умови праці
    4. #4. Робочі години 
    5. #5. Сервісні пропозиції
    6. #6. Клієнти
    7. № 7. Створіть портфоліо
    8. #8. Визначте свої тарифи
    9. #9. Знайдіть свою цільову аудиторію
    10. #10. Розвивайте свої здібності
    11. #11. Конкретні клієнти 
    12. #12. Підготуйте договір
    13. #13. Продовжуйте вивчати нове
  7. Робота позаштатного розробника програмного забезпечення
  8. Чи можу я бути позаштатним розробником програмного забезпечення?
  9. Скільки ви можете заробити як позаштатний розробник програмного забезпечення?
  10. Чи вартий фріланс програміста?
  11. Чи можу я заробити 100 тисяч на фрілансі?
  12. Чи важко бути позаштатним розробником?
  13. Як почати фрілансерне програмування без досвіду?
  14. Скільки стягують фрілансери Python за годину?
  15. Висновок 
  16. Статті по темі
  17. посилання 

Незалежний розробник програмного забезпечення може працювати з будь-якого місця. Більшість розробників програмного забезпечення-фрілансера беруться за проекти та можуть допомогти бізнесу вирішити проблеми з програмним забезпеченням або створити веб-сайти для клієнтів. Розробник програмного забезпечення, який працює на себе, зазвичай працює сам і віддалено. Багато незалежних розробників програмного забезпечення працюють з дому, але деякі користуються можливістю подорожувати, заробляючи гроші. Якщо ви плануєте працювати незалежним розробником програмного забезпечення, дізнавшись більше про посаду та ваші можливості в галузі, ви зможете вирішити, чи підходить вона вам. У цій статті описано кроки, як стати незалежним розробником програмного забезпечення, а також інформацію про те, чим вони займаються та очікувані зарплати.

Незалежний розробник програмного забезпечення

Бути фрілансером вимагає від вас уміння рекламувати як себе, так і свої послуги, а також знання основ управління бізнесом, таких як створення бюджету, подання податкових декларацій і ведення точного обліку. Численні клієнти обслуговуються одночасно розробниками-фрілансерами, але деякі можуть віддати перевагу укласти контракт лише з однією фірмою одночасно.

Фахівці з інформатики, відомі як розробники програмного забезпечення, пишуть комп’ютерні програми та програми. Вони вміють писати «код», який робить функції програмного забезпечення можливими за допомогою мов комп’ютерного програмування. Спеціальність в одній або кількох областях розробки програмного забезпечення, наприклад веб-розробка або розробка баз даних, типова для досвідчених розробників програмного забезпечення.

Більшість розробників-фрілансерів беруться за проекти та можуть допомогти бізнесу вирішити проблеми програмного забезпечення з додатком або створити веб-сайт для клієнта. Ви можете знайти роботу на онлайн-платформах для фрілансерів, якщо ви самозайнятий розробник програмного забезпечення.

Переваги стати позаштатним розробником програмного забезпечення

#1. Збільште свій дохід

Немає обмежень щодо кількості проектів, над якими може працювати одна людина одночасно. Якщо ви володієте багатьма, якщо не всіма, професіями, ви можете взятися за кілька проектів, які вимагають різних здібностей, і працювати над ними всіма одночасно, якщо ви багатообізнані. Роблячи це, ви збільшите свою ефективність і дохід. 

#2. Ви відповідальний

Той факт, що ви керуєте власним бізнесом як позаштатний розробник програмного забезпечення, безсумнівно, є найбільшою перевагою. Типи клієнтів і осіб, з якими ви обираєте працювати, повністю під вашим контролем. Як незалежний розробник програмного забезпечення ви маєте право відмовитися від роботи з клієнтами, які висувають необґрунтовані вимоги. 

#3. Міжнародний охоплення 

Ви дізнаєтеся про різні культури роботи та стилі спілкування завдяки досвіду роботи з міжнародними клієнтами. Побудова важливих ділових стосунків дасть вам можливість об’єднати контакти та розширити мережу. Під час роботи над проектом ви можете співпрацювати з додатковими незалежними розробниками програмного забезпечення. 

# 4. Гнучкість

Ви контролюєте, коли ви працюєте, роботу, яку ви обираєте, і методи, які використовуєте для її виконання. Від програмістів-фрілансерів навряд чи вимагатимуть працювати з 9 ранку до 5 вечора в офісі, якщо в договорі не вказано конкретну кількість годин або місце.

Недоліки позаштатного розробника програмного забезпечення

#1. Нестабільна зайнятість 

Коли ваші поточні контракти закінчуються, ви завжди повинні шукати нові, щоб взяти на себе нові. Дуже важливо мати резервний план, оскільки контракти іноді можуть закінчуватися з різних непередбачуваних причин. Окрім того, щоб бути програмістом, ви повинні вміти розміщувати свій бренд, продавати свої знання та налагоджувати ділові стосунки.

# 2. Фінансова нестабільність

Коли ви працюєте фрілансером, час вашої наступної зарплати невідомий. Довгострокова фінансова стабільність не є даністю, коли ви фрілансер. Залежно від вашого попереднього проекту ваші прибутки можуть бути вищими чи нижчими.

#3. Напружений графік 

Бувають моменти, коли працювати поодинці буває дуже важко. Згодом вам доведеться стежити за багатьма речами, включаючи дотримання термінів, створення пропозицій і оновлення веб-сайту.

Посадова інструкція позаштатного розробника програмного забезпечення

Посадова інструкція розробника програмного забезпечення може містити таку інформацію:

  • Дослідження, розробка, впровадження та управління програмним забезпеченням
  • Тестування та оцінка нової програми
  • Пошук потенційних сфер для змін в існуючих програмах, а потім впровадження цих змін
  • Створення та використання ефективного коду
  • Встановлення працездатності
  • Створення засобів контролю якості
  • Впровадження програмних засобів, методів і показників
  • Оновлення та підтримка поточних систем
  • Навчання користувачів
  • Тісна співпраця з іншими розробниками, дизайнерами UX, бізнес-аналітиками та системними аналітиками

Зарплата позаштатного розробника програмного забезпечення

Можливо, вам цікаво, скільки праці та грошей ви можете заробити як незалежний розробник програмного забезпечення тепер, коли знаєте, як почати. Середня річна зарплата розробників становить 79,398 XNUMX доларів. Як фрілансер, ви часто визначаєте свої ставки та базуєте свою оплату на кількох змінних. Залежно від вашого рівня досвіду ви можете вирішити стягувати більше або менше, ніж діюча ставка для штатних працівників галузі.

Шукайте способи посилити свої облікові дані та пропозиції послуг, якщо ви хочете збільшити свій дохід. Щоб дізнатися, які навички та вимоги є найбільш затребуваними, подивіться оголошення про роботу для незалежних розробників програмного забезпечення. Якщо ви можете адаптувати своє портфоліо, резюме та набір навичок відповідно до потреб звичайних клієнтів або конкретних проектів, ви можете часто підвищувати свої ставки, щоб відображати свій рівень знань. 

Як стати позаштатним розробником програмного забезпечення 

Ось кілька дій, які ви можете зробити, якщо вам цікаво дізнатися, як працювати позаштатним розробником програмного забезпечення:

#1. Розвивайте свою нішу

Наявність певного набору навичок, який відрізняє вас від інших професіоналів-фрілансерів, є корисним для роботи незалежним розробником програмного забезпечення. Ви можете вирішити зосередитися на розробці програмного забезпечення в певній галузі, наприклад, налагодженні програм, отримати сертифікат або вивчити певну мову кодування. Крім того, наявність певних навичок і сертифікатів може полегшити роботодавцям пошук вас під час пошуку кандидатів. 

#2. Встановіть чіткі очікування

Ви можете переконатися, що ви підтримуєте продуктивні методи роботи та створюєте послідовність у своєму професійному житті, чітко окресливши свої очікування. Знання цінності вашого часу та роботи може полегшити висловлення ваших потреб клієнтам і прийняття рішення, якщо проект не відповідає тому, як ви віддаєте перевагу роботі.

#3. Умови праці

Замість того, щоб використовувати офісні приміщення свого роботодавця, незалежні розробники програмного забезпечення часто працюють віддалено. Щоб розділити особисте та професійне життя, ви можете вирішити створити домашній офіс.

#4. Робочі години 

Скільки ви плануєте працювати щотижня, є корисним додатковим критерієм для встановлення. Беріть лише тих клієнтів і проекти, які відповідають параметрам, які ви встановили.

#5. Сервісні пропозиції

Ви можете вирішити встановити обмеження на послуги, які ви надаєте, або типи робіт, на які ви готові погодитися. Наприклад, замість розробки нового програмного забезпечення ви можете лише надавати консультаційні послуги або зосередитися на використанні існуючих програм. 

# 6. Клієнти

Ви також можете обмежити кількість клієнтів, з якими ви працюєте одночасно. Важливими факторами також можуть бути типи клієнтів або розмір бізнесу, з якими вам комфортно працювати. 

№ 7. Створіть портфоліо

Ваші найкращі роботи, похвальні зауваження, рекомендації експертів та інші докази ваших здібностей – все це можна зберігати в портфоліо. Маючи портфоліо, вам буде легко та зручно демонструвати свою роботу потенційним клієнтам.

Потенційним роботодавцям легше зрозуміти ваш досвід і навички, якщо ви додасте посилання на своє портфоліо або розмістите його в професійних додатках. Докладіть зусиль, щоб вибрати роботи, які, на вашу думку, найкраще відображатимуть ваші здібності та стиль.

Подумайте про додавання розділів до свого портфоліо, які ефективно просуватимуть ваші повноваження, якщо ви є експертом у певній галузі роботи або маєте розширені сертифікати.

#8. Визначте свої тарифи

Заздалегідь визначені комісії можуть полегшити роботу з клієнтами та забезпечити справедливу оплату за ваш час і послуги. Ви можете стягувати плату за проект або годину за свої послуги, але переконайтеся, що ваші тарифи відображають ваш рівень знань, ваші технічні знання та ваші потреби з точки зору способу життя.

#9. Знайдіть свою цільову аудиторію

Знання відповідних місць для реклами ваших послуг є важливим першим кроком у самомаркетингу. Виберіть найкращі методи зв’язку з клієнтами, з якими ви найбільше прагнете працювати, пам’ятаючи, хто вони.

Замість того, щоб знижувати ціни, щоб задовольнити клієнтів із обмеженим бюджетом, переконайтеся, що знайшли ринки та аудиторію, які можуть дозволити собі сплатити ваші збори. Щоб знайти можливості з клієнтами, увагу яких ви найбільше зацікавлені, ви можете використовувати веб-сайти фрілансерів, мережеві інструменти та веб-сайти пошуку роботи. 

#10. Розвивайте свої здібності

Визначивши свої тарифи та цільовий ринок, спробуйте продати їм свої навички. Роблячи це, ви можете сприяти поширенню інформації про послуги, які ви пропонуєте, і підвищити ймовірність того, що потенційні клієнти знайдуть вас.

Оскільки ви є тим, хто повинен рекламувати себе, переконайтеся, що ви ефективно виражаєте свій досвід і здібності. Веб-сайти для незалежних розробників програмного забезпечення та особисті оголошення можуть бути ефективними інструментами для поширення інформації про ваші послуги.

#11. Конкретні клієнти 

Розбірливість може допомогти вам підтримувати стандарти чи ставки та зберегти вашу роботу привабливою для роботодавців. Дізнайтеся якомога більше про ділові процедури та норми спілкування ваших потенційних клієнтів, перш ніж вибрати, з ким працювати.

Ви можете поділитися своїм портфоліо або подати заявку, коли визначите, що цінності клієнта збігаються з вашими та можуть відповідати вашим вимогам. Якщо до вас звертаються компанії, подумайте про отримання інформації про їхні очікування, стиль управління та цінності. Вашу професійну сумісність із клієнтом можна визначити за його відповідями. 

#12. Підготуйте договір

Перш ніж почати роботу над проектом, для якого ви погодилися найняти, спробуйте скласти контракт. Це допоможе формально встановити керівні принципи вашої контрактної роботи з компанією як фрілансера. У цих угодах часто деталізується винагорода, яку ви отримуєте від компанії, робота, яку ви виконуєте, і тривалість вашого партнерства з нею.

#13. Продовжуйте вивчати нове

Підтримувати свою життєздатність і підтримувати свої навички в актуальному стані можна, йдучи в ногу з галузевими розробками та корисними сертифікатами. Подумайте про отримання додаткових сертифікатів або пошук можливостей для навчання протягом усього життя. Інвестуючи у свій професійний розвиток, ви можете отримати кращі можливості працевлаштування та заробити більше грошей.

Бути кращим фрілансером вимагає постійної цікавості до найновіших мов програмування та технологічних досягнень. Щоб бути в курсі останніх подій, ви можете підписатися на інформаційні бюлетені та публікації, записатися на швидкі онлайн-курси, читати блоги тощо. Ви можете розвинути навички, які мають відношення до галузі, дотримуючись цих кроків. Це підвищить ваш потенціал прибутку та залучить більше клієнтів з часом.

Робота позаштатного розробника програмного забезпечення

Веб-сайти та комп’ютерні програми залежать від роботи незалежних розробників програмного забезпечення. «Внутрішня частина» додатків — та їхня частина, яку користувачі не бачать — створюється за допомогою мов і методів кодування. Це вказує на те, що ці фахівці створюють базові системи, які дозволяють і полегшують роботу веб-сайтів і програм. Ось типові обов’язки для незалежних розробників програмного забезпечення: 

  • Проектування прикладних систем
  • Надання клієнтам консультацій щодо оновлення програмного забезпечення
  • Розробка веб-сайтів через код
  • Пошук клієнтів
  • Взаємодія з клієнтами, щоб дізнатися про їхні потреби
  • Підтримуйте особистий веб-сайт або портфоліо в актуальному стані 

Чи можу я бути позаштатним розробником програмного забезпечення?

Компанії в різних галузях наймають незалежних розробників програмного забезпечення для виконання проектів і вирішення проблем, пов’язаних із програмним забезпеченням. Більшість незалежних розробників програмного забезпечення беруться за проекти та можуть допомогти бізнесу вирішити проблеми програмного забезпечення з додатком або створити веб-сайт для клієнта.

Скільки ви можете заробити як позаштатний розробник програмного забезпечення?

Станом на 79,398 квітня 12 року середня зарплата розробника програмного забезпечення-фрілансера в США становить $2023 XNUMX на рік.

Чи вартий фріланс програміста?

Якщо у вас є здібності та цілеспрямованість, ви можете добре заробляти на життя програмістом-фрілансером. Деякі програмісти заробляють більше грошей, працюючи на себе, ніж на звичайній роботі. Середня річна зарплата програмістів становить 69,193 XNUMX долари. Ви можете визначити свої тарифи як програміст-фрілансер.

Чи можу я заробити 100 тисяч на фрілансі?

Безсумнівно, фріланс може допомогти вам отримати зарплату, яка дозволить вам комфортно утримувати свою сім’ю. Крім того, не неможливо заробити шестизначну цифру (і більше) як фрілансер.

Чи важко бути позаштатним розробником?

Фрілансерська веб-розробка складна. Це тонна роботи. Однак переваги способу життя фрілансера значно переважують усе інше. Ви повинні створити репутацію старанного працівника, а також надійного, етичного веб-розробника.

Як почати фрілансерне програмування без досвіду?

  • Знайдіть свою нішу та навчіться кодувати
  • Отримайте досвід, створивши портфоліо 
  • Створіть свій веб-сайт
  • Створіть свою присутність в Інтернеті
  • Налаштуйте профілі на порталах фрілансерів
  • Мережа з іншими програмістами 
  • Отримайте сертифікати 
  • Почніть шукати клієнтів і працювати 
  • Отримайте рефералів і створіть список клієнтів

Скільки стягують фрілансери Python за годину?

За даними ZipRecruiter, погодинна ставка для розробника Python у США станом на 12 квітня 2023 року коливається від 54.52 до 55 доларів. 

Висновок 

Для підтримки функціональності веб-сайтів, мобільних додатків і систем комп’ютерного програмного забезпечення наймаються незалежні розробники програмного забезпечення. Працювати незалежним веб-розробником може бути привабливо. Робота над цікавими проектами, можливість вільно відвідувати технічні заходи та брати участь у технічних спільнотах, працювати вдома, подорожувати та мати кращий баланс між роботою та особистим життям – усе це переваги.

ІТ-спеціалісти, які працюють як позаштатні розробники програмного забезпечення, а не платні працівники, відомі як позаштатні розробники програмного забезпечення. Це часто дає цим професіоналам більше свободи вибору типу роботи, яку вони виконують, і середовища, в якому вони її виконують. Важливо розуміти доступні можливості фрілансера, якщо ви зацікавлені у використанні своїх навичок розробника програмного забезпечення для завершення проектів.

  1. ВЕБ-РОЗРОБКА ФРІЛАНС: як розпочати свою роботу та укласти контракт.
  2. РОЗРОБНИК-ФРІЛАНС: усе, що вам потрібно про це знати, і як почати працювати на фрілансі
  3. БІЗНЕС РЕЄСТРАЦІЇ НЕРУХОМОСТІ: Як стати забудовником і детальні кроки для створення компанії
  4. ФРІЛАНС-МАРКЕТИНГ: Що робити та зарплата
  5. Що таке веб-дизайн: визначення, приклад, програмне забезпечення, курс і пакет

посилання 

залишити коментар

Ваша електронна адреса не буде опублікований. Обов'язкові поля позначені * *

Вам також може сподобатися
Цифровий менеджер з маркетингу
Детальніше

МЕНЕДЖЕР З ЦИФРОВОГО МАРКЕТИНГУ: значення, обов’язки, зарплата, питання для співбесіди та резюме

Зміст Сховати Менеджер з цифрового маркетингу Опис посади менеджера з цифрового маркетингу №1. Опис роботи №2. Що означає цифровий маркетинг…
ТЕОРІЯ ЦІЛЕПОЛАГАННЯ
Детальніше

ТЕОРІЯ ПОСТАНОВЛЕННЯ ЦІЛЕЙ: визначення, як її використовувати, плюси і мінуси

Зміст Приховати Що таке теорія постановки цілей? Мета теорії постановки цілей Як працює теорія постановки цілей Теорія постановки цілей автора...